    2024 Paris Olympic Games: Favour Ofili Qualifies for 200m final

    Favour Ofili
    Favour Ofili

    Nigerian athlete, Favour Ofili has secured a spot in the final of the women’s 200m event at the ongoing Paris Olympic Games.

    Ofili finished second with a season’s best time of 22.05s behind Julien Alfred, who won the first semi final race with a time of 21.98s on Monday.

    Ofili’s success is historic as she becomes the first Nigerian since Mary Onyali to qualify for the 200m final, at the Olympics.

    Meanwhile, in the men’s race, Udodi Onwuzurike will get a second chance to become the fourth Nigerian man to reach the semifinals of the 200m at the Olympics.

    After finishing fifth in his opening round heat, he will compete in the Repechage Round, reserved for athletes who failed to secure automatic semifinal spots.
